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3495510 6179707 78906 241 551052
220 37 36721
220 37 36721
31413 781 0529768357
All about undefined
Interested in learning more?
220 37 36721
31413 781 0529768357
See more
92193916791 023364 9563
69412 862547523 980563 843176
See more
7526381 021
5203 66 416712621
See more